Ok....most of us realize we need a change at the top so we can get to a reasonable debate on America.
I want to also preface this by saying I’m not a conservative to the point that hates all regulations and thinks the epa and osha need closed down. There are reasonable regulations that help everyone and these departments are needed.
But, I’m starting this thread to discuss this issue. We need REASONABLE regulations.
I have preached in our company since day one that we WILL abide by OSHA and EPA regulations because I want a company that employees are safe and we aren’t damaging the communities we are in.
But, today just about sent me over the edge.
We had an OSHA rep in to do a walk through. We actually invited him in because I want a safe place.
Just one example of what he came back with.
We have to have a document for every single piece of equipment in our facility on how to operate it. With this document, we are required to document every possible way someone can be injured with it.
We have 7 buildings with everything from specialized production equipment, fork lifts, yard lifts, normal maintenance equipment, Cnc machines, milling machines, lathes, vehicles, drills, saws.....etc.
My safety manager is looking at me and saying....how the f#&%?
we also have to have documented how the OSHA rep is to operate the equipment when they walk in.
we have equipment that takes months to learn how to operate and he said the rep should be able to operate it when he gets here. WTF?
I will continue to preach safety in our company, but this is an example of how there is no way we can cover everything and I feel they are just wanting a way to fine us anytime they want.
